Iran tests weaons across Hormuz

Iran has test-fired a range of weapons during military exercises near the Strait of Hormuz, the passageway for one-fifth of the world’s oil supply.

Its air defence system Raad, or Thunder, was among those tested, with torpedoes and underwater and surface-to-surface rockets as well as anti-ship missiles.
